The short answer

Yes, without reservation. God's love for you is not based on your performance, your past, or how put-together you feel. He loved you before you could do anything to earn it, and that love has never changed.

What Scripture Says

"But God proves His love for us in this: While we were still sinners, Christ died for us."

Romans 5:8

"For I am convinced that neither death nor life, neither angels nor principalities, neither the present nor the future, nor any powers,"

Romans 8:38

"neither height nor depth, nor anything else in all creation, will be able to separate us from the love of God that is in Christ Jesus our Lord."

Romans 8:39

"We love because He first loved us."

1 John 4:19

"The LORD your God is in your midst, a mighty One who saves. He will rejoice over you with gladness; He will quiet you with His love; He will exult over you with singing."

Zephaniah 3:17

Going Deeper

One of the hardest truths to believe is that you are already loved — right now, as you are, not as some improved future version of yourself. God did not wait for you to get it right. He came for you while you were still in the mess. Nothing in all creation can separate you from that kind of love.
